A sport weight yarn is equivalent to a 5-ply. Recommended Knitting Needle and Crochet Hook Sizes for Sport Weight. Sport weight is classified as a #2 fine/baby weight yarn, with an approximate gauge of 23-26 stitches per four inches (10cm) in knitting gauge.

So obviously, the number of plies increase as the weight does – but what exactly is a ply ? Plied yarns are composed of two or more single yarns twisted together . 2-ply yarn, for example, is composed of two single strands, and a 3-ply yarn is composed of three ...
